Kyle, where is the data/tests to show this for current AMD systems?

Hitman (most responsive game to ram speed I've found) using DX 12 and looking at minimum frame rate as in percentages, tighter timings as well as ram speed work together. Using Stilts 3300 safe and OC FSB to get 3500mhz in the past gave the best results but in the end, at least for me it was not significant enough. For productivity programs it was virtually nothing. Dug up some old data, configuration was 1700x, Asus Crosshair Hero 6, 3.9ghz, TridenZ memory (Samsung B modules) 2 x 8gb, Gigabyte 1070 G1. These are Stilts settings which were later incorporated into the Bios on ASUS boards, very tight timing settings. Looking at the lower percentiles and averages. For this setup the biggest change was going with tighter timings at 3200 from 3200 DOCP to 3200 Stilts Safe timings while faster speed memory and tight timings helped. Unfortunately data is incomplete now as in resolution tested at. Anyways, request this be looked at in a professional serious way so folks do not spend way more money they need to spend for very limited improvements for very isolated particular cases. This was best case I've found back in 2017 with memory speeds besides 3500 not shown below, the data below it was cut out, consisting of over 10,000 frames for each test run.

Based on that chart, 3400 CL16 would land bellow 3200 Safe.
OF course real-world and application specific programs will very in results.

Hey guys! Today i began to overclock my 2950X and what i found was a little unbelievable. I got 4.0ghz all core stable at 1.25V and got as far as 4.3ghz at only 1.425V
My Cinebench Score is 3545 Points Multi Core score.

I've never heard of any 2950x going that high and never read of a 4.0ghz all core oc that only needed 1.25V

Did I find the holy grail of threadrippers?
